The Southern Pulse of Epirus: Stone Networks, River Gorges, and the Isolated Connectivity of the Zagori Villages

An in-depth analysis of the road and stone-bridge network sustaining the mountainous Zagori region in Greece, examining the synergy between centennial pathways, vernacular architecture, and human resilience against geographical isolation.

In northwestern Greece, where the Pindos mountain range unfolds its imposing anatomy of limestone and forested abysses, the Zagori region stands as a living testament to human adaptation to one of the most rugged environments in the Balkan Peninsula. This territory, composed of forty-six villages traditionally known as the Zagorohoria, was not shaped by the logic of grand imperial trade routes, but by the imperative need of its communities to stay connected across unfathomable gorges, steep slopes, and turbulent river currents. Far from constituting a mere passive refuge, Zagori represents a masterpiece of vernacular civil engineering, where every paved path and stone arch answers a precise calculation of survival and territorial cohesion.

For centuries, the isolation of these valleys hanging over the void could only be broken by constructing a network of cobblestone paths, locally known as skalades, and a bold architecture of single, double, and triple-arched stone bridges. These infrastructures not only allowed the transit of people and goods between villages separated by monumental canyons like the Vikos Gorge, but also secured the economic viability of a society based on high-altitude pastoralism, artisanal trade, and the seasonal migration of master builders. Analyzing Zagori today requires understanding how this ancestral network continues to condition mobility, tourism, and cultural preservation in the mountainous heart of Epirus.

The Geography of Abysses: The Physical Framework of the Zagorohoria

The relief of Zagori is dominated by the imposing presence of the Vikos Canyon, recognized by the Guinness Book of Records as the deepest gorge in the world relative to its width, with vertical walls plunging more than a thousand meters toward the bed of the Voidomatis River. This geological fracture acts simultaneously as an impassable barrier and as a structuring axis for the territory. Local communities did not settle at the bottom of the valleys due to the risk of flooding and the unhealthiness of historical marshlands, but rather on hanging plateaus and protected slopes beneath the peaks of Mount Tymfi.

Connectivity between these settlements required overcoming monumental elevation changes within hours of walking. Local geologists and historians agree that the stability of the clay and karst slopes dictated the layout of the paths. Each village functioned as an autonomous yet interdependent node, where the lack of passable roads during winter months meant absolute vulnerability. This fragility prompted community councils to invest considerable sums of their own resources, often funded by the generosity of the Zagorian mercantile diaspora in Central Europe and Constantinople, to erect safe crossings over seasonal torrents.

The Engineering of Skalades: Cobbled Pathways on the Slope

The skalades are much more than simple mountain trails; they form a network of meandering, meticulously paved tracks made from local stone slabs, designed with a consistent gradient that allowed the safe passage of mule trains laden with heavy goods. Constructing these paths required deep knowledge of mountain soil dynamics. To prevent autumn and winter downpours from washing away the surface, traditional builders integrated complex transverse drainage systems, gutters carved into living rock, and dry-stone retaining walls capable of supporting tons of earth and stone.

An outstanding example of this pedestrian engineering is the famous Vradeto staircase, a monumental layout winding through the rocky cliff face and overcoming an elevation gain of over a thousand meters via eleven hundred carved stone steps. Built in the late 18th century, this pathway was for generations the sole land link between the village of Vradeto and the rest of the plateau. The precision with which the cornerstones were positioned ensures that, despite centuries and the region’s recurring seismic activity, much of this infrastructure remains operational and traversable for contemporary hikers.

Single-Arch Bridges: Geometric Boldness Over the Voidomatis

If the skalades represent the horizontal and vertical arteries of the territory, the stone bridges constitute the structural landmarks spanning the river abysses. Built overwhelmingly during the 18th and 19th centuries by itinerant local craftsmen known as mastoroi, these bridges stand out for their slender single arches, designed to withstand sudden spring snowmelt floods without central piers obstructing the water flow.

Stone does not impose itself on the landscape in Zagori; it bends to its physical laws to become the only possible bridge between isolation and community.

The Kokkoris Bridge, situated over the Aetomilitsa River, or the elegant triple-arched Plakidas Bridge are paradigmatic examples of this construction mastery. Master stonemasons used temporary wooden centering and native lime mortar, adjusting the keystone voussoirs with millimetric precision. The pronounced curvature of these bridges, often referred to as donkey-backs, did not respond to aesthetic caprice, but to the need to confer greater compressive strength on the central part of the structure, allowing them to support the constant traffic of livestock and commercial caravans.

Vernacular Architecture: Slate, Timber, and Community Cohesion

The physical connectivity of Zagori is not limited to its paths and bridges; it extends into the very structure of its villages, where civil and religious architecture reflects a seamless synergy with the geological surroundings. Traditional homes, locally known as archontika, are built entirely from local gray and brown stone, without modern cements, using only mud and lime. The roofs are covered with heavy local slate slabs, quarried nearby and laid overlapping to withstand the weight of heavy winter snowfalls.

This material and aesthetic uniformity serves a clear logistical function: building materials were available within a short distance, drastically reducing the need for heavy, long-distance transport. Village squares, called horio, and public stone fountains connected by underground spring networks act as nerve centers where the routes of shepherds and travelers converged, consolidating a staunch community identity based on self-sufficiency and mutual aid.

Decline and Transformation: From Abandonment to Sustainable Tourism

With the arrival of the paved road network in the mid-20th century, which directly connected the main localities of Zagori to the city of Ioannina for the first time, the original function of the skalades and traditional bridges underwent a radical transformation. The ancient caravan routes lost their immediate economic value, and many villages suffered a drastic depopulation process due to migration toward urban centers and abroad, leaving behind an infrastructural heritage at risk of abandonment.

However, in recent decades, this relative isolation has turned into the region’s primary asset. The rise of ecotourism and high-quality hiking has enabled the recovery and maintenance of a large portion of the traditional path network. Local organizations and conservation associations have promoted the clearing and marking of the skalades, transforming a legacy of economic survival into a cultural and active tourism corridor that attracts visitors from around the world without disrupting the fragility of the mountain ecosystem.

Practical guide

Planning a journey through the network of historical paths and bridges in Zagori requires understanding the geographical and climatic particularities of this mountainous region in northern Greece.

    How to get there: The primary gateway to the region is the city of Ioannina, whose national airport connects with Athens and which features regular bus services (KTEL). From Ioannina, the most efficient option to explore the Zagori villages is renting a vehicle, which is essential for accessing more remote hamlets.

    Best time to visit: Spring (May to June) offers optimal temperatures, blooming fields, and vigorous river flows. Autumn (September to November) stands out for the chromatic palette of deciduous forests. Winter can temporarily isolate certain areas due to heavy snowfalls.

    Trail network: Many paths are thoroughly marked, but it is advisable to acquire a detailed topographic map of the region or use offline GPS applications, as mobile phone coverage can be limited at the bottom of gorges.

    Accommodation and gastronomy: Many former stone mansions (archontika) have been restored as boutique hotels and traditional guesthouses. Local gastronomy is based on pasture-raised meats, artisanal goat cheeses, and savory pies (pita) made with thin dough and wild greens.

    Conservation rules: Throwing garbage on trails, damaging dry-stone masonry, or altering historical bridges is strictly prohibited. Respect for the natural and architectural environment is the sole guarantee for preserving this protected cultural landscape.
